Overview
Regular stock takes ensure the inventory levels in your account are accurate.
Options:
- require that all items get counted - so the only items in a location after the stocktake will be the ones counted
- enable updates only on items you do count
Stocktakes are designed as a blind two count process to cross check counts.
A Stocktake will be compared to current stock levels when completed and will write appropriate journals to write off or create stock
You will need the Secure Features ''Is Stock Manager''
Set stock locations that store stock to "Lot"
When setting up a new company that has existing stock - you can count the stock and not write journals - instead using a single journal line for the stock value.
This feature can also be used to count stock that you do not need to do journals for adjustments - for example stock held on consignment
Doing a regular Stocktake
Until you get experienced - count a single warehouse bay at a time.
- Have the Secure Features ''Is Stock Manager''
- Set stock locations that store stock to "Lot"
Select the area that will be counted in one count
- Counted Items Only - Only the items counted will be updated - all other items in the locations will remain at current stock levels
- Full - only stock counted will remain in the bay after counting
- Notes might be useful later
Start first count
To start the first count
To Count
Multiple users may be entering data for a count at the same time
Finish first count and start second count
When ready to finish first count
Can compare with system stock levels before closing
Or can simply close first count and begin second count.
Second Counters find stocktake that needs a second count
If the stocktake does not need a second count - copy the first count to a second count
Count the stock in the same way as the first count.
Comparing 1st and 2nd Counts
Close Second Count and Report Differences
Any differences will show in a report - allowing a recount of any discrepancies
Simply update the counts until you are convinced the second count is correct.
Report differences again
After any changes to counts you will need to report differences again to proceed
Comparing Second Count to System Stock Levels
Again a list will show - recheck and update any counts you want
Journal Stock Differences
Will create the required journals
Stock take adjustment GL account is configured in Symbols Config as "Stock TakeAdjustmentGLCode"
User will require the Secure Feature "Can Record Stock Adjustment"
Status will become closed.
A stocktake can be cancelled at any time, unless it has a status of Cancelled or Closed, by choosing 'Cancel Stocktake without updating' from the Status/Action menu.
